RHINATHIOL CHILDREN EXPECTORANT — EFFECTIVE RELIEF FOR CHESTY COUGHS

Rhinathiol Children is a trusted, raspberry-and-cherry flavored syrup specifically formulated to help children clear mucus from their airways. It contains Carbocisteine, a powerful mucolytic agent. Unlike cough suppressants that stop a cough, Rhinathiol works by thinning and "breaking up" thick, sticky phlegm (mucus). This makes the mucus less viscous and much easier for the child to cough up, clearing the bronchial tubes and making breathing more comfortable.

  • Product Type: Mucolytic (Mucus-thinning) Expectorant

  • Active Ingredient: Carbocisteine (2% — 100mg per 5ml)

  • Manufacturer: Sanofi

  • Pack Size: 125ml Bottle (includes a graduated measuring spoon/cup)

  • Route: Oral

  • Availability: Over-the-Counter (OTC) — Pharmacist consultation recommended

  • Suitable For: Children aged 2 to 12 years


What Is Rhinathiol Children Used For?

Rhinathiol is indicated for the treatment of respiratory disorders characterized by excessive or thick mucus. It is particularly effective for:

  1. Chesty (Productive) Coughs: Helping the child expel the phlegm that causes a "rattling" sound in the chest.

  2. Bronchitis: Reducing the thickness of mucus during acute bronchial infections.

  3. Congestion Relief: Clearing the airways so the child can breathe and sleep more easily.

  4. Post-Infection Recovery: Helping the lungs clear out remaining mucus after a cold or flu has passed.


⚠️ Important Safety Warning

Age Restriction: Do not give Rhinathiol to children under 2 years of age, as they cannot cough effectively enough to clear the thinned mucus, which may lead to airway obstruction. Not for Dry Coughs: If your child has a tickly, dry cough with no phlegm, this medicine is not appropriate. Stomach Ulcers: Use with caution if the child has a history of stomach or intestinal ulcers. Diabetic Note: This syrup contains sucrose. If your child has a sugar intolerance or diabetes, consult our pharmacist before use.


How to Use

Dosage is based on the child's age. Always use the measuring device provided in the box.

Standard Dosage Guidelines:

  • Children 2 to 5 years: One 5ml measuring spoonful twice daily.

  • Children over 5 years: One 5ml measuring spoonful three times daily.

Application Tips:

  • Hydration: Encourage your child to drink plenty of water while taking Rhinathiol. Fluids help the Carbocisteine work better at thinning the mucus.

  • Timing: Avoid giving the last dose immediately before bedtime. It is better to give it at least 1 to 2 hours before sleep so the child has time to cough up the loosened mucus before lying down.

  • Duration: Do not use for more than 8 to 10 days without consulting a doctor.


Common Side Effects

Rhinathiol is generally well-tolerated. Some children may experience mild digestive upset, such as nausea, diarrhea, or stomach pain. Rarely, a skin rash may occur. If your child develops swelling of the face, difficulty breathing, or dark, "tarry" stools, stop the medication immediately and seek medical attention.


Storage Instructions

Store in a cool, dry place below 25°C, away from direct sunlight. Do not freeze. Ensure the cap is tightly closed after every use. Keep out of reach of children.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can I give this with "Paracetamol"?

A: Yes. Rhinathiol does not interact with Paracetamol (Panadol/Calpol). It is safe to use both if the child also has a fever.

Q: Why is my child coughing more after taking it?

A: This is actually a sign the medicine is working. Because the mucus is now thinner, the body’s natural reflex is to cough it out. This "productive" coughing is necessary to clear the chest.

Q: Can I mix it with another cough syrup?

A: No. Never mix Rhinathiol with a "Cough Suppressant" (antitussive). Suppressants stop the coughing reflex, which would trap the thinned mucus in the lungs and could lead to a chest infection.

Q: Does it contain alcohol?

A: No. Rhinathiol Children is alcohol-free and formulated specifically for pediatric safety.
